The Campaign
National Cancer Institution 500 500 will be the largest hospital that to treat cancer patients in Egypt, as number of cancer patients increase with a significant rate annually.
This is a film with a strong message of mass solidarity from everyone in Egypt to help fight Cancer.
It is translated visually; by a crowd of Egyptians holding up a young boy visibly treated by cancer and is surfing happily on a lively crowd in the different streets of Cairo in a cheerful and joyful manner.
The crowd is made of Egyptian citizens, which are all cheering the young boy as if to celebrate life and helping him to reach a destination despite all obstacles. This destination is 500500 hospital.
This strong analogy is a message of help, and an invitation to donate and fight Cancer translated in a simple visual of mass solidarity.
